How Much Does a Private ADHD Assessment Cost?

A private assessment for adhd private assessment ireland can be expensive but it's well worth the money if you need to obtain a reliable diagnosis. These tests are carried out in a professional environment by mental health professionals who can help you better understand your condition.

ADHD awareness has soared in recent months in recent months, with Loose Women host Nadia Sawalha recently sharing her experience of being diagnosed as an adult. Experts have warned of long waiting times and an absence of awareness of the clinical signs can put those awaiting a diagnoses in a dangerous situation.

Cost

The cost of an ADHD evaluation is based on where you live and which doctor you choose. You can get online estimates from a variety of private psychiatrists or request your GP to refer you to a national program like Maudsley ADHD in London. These services provide more comprehensive assessments than those offered by the NHS however they can be more expensive. In some instances the costs could be covered by insurance or by a charity organisation which makes them more affordable for some people.

A private physician can offer more rapid diagnosis and be more inclined to prescribe medications. When making a diagnosis, they will also take into consideration your family and personal background. They will also consider any other medical conditions that may be contributing to the symptoms you're experiencing like depression or anxiety. Adult ADHD specialists can offer a more professional and speedy service. They may also be able to prescribe medication.

The typical initial assessment will comprise reading screening tools and a clinical interview with a psychiatrist. The psychiatrist will then prepare a report and issue an order for medication, if needed. The psychiatrist can also provide advice on ongoing behavioural support and other therapies.

Time

ADHD is a complicated condition and requires a thorough evaluation. private adhd assessment liverpool cost assessment providers can inquire about your symptoms and family history, and recommend other diagnostic tests or recommend you to a mental health professional. These assessments can take some time however, they are worth the time. These assessments will help you know your symptoms and provide you a treatment plan.

In the UK In the UK, it isn't always easy to receive an ADHD diagnosis because of the lack of resources and investment in NHS services. However, you can attempt to cut down on wait times by seeking an appointment with your GP. Certain private assessment services are contracted with local CCGs and provide shorter waiting times. They also have shared-care agreements with GPs. This can help you save money on the cost of medication.

A private adhd assessment gloucestershire ADHD assessment includes a clinical interview conducted by a psychiatrist. During the interview, the psychiatrist will ask you about your history and the effects of ADHD symptoms on your daily routine. They will also rule out other mental health issues, such as depression or anxiety. If you're a parent with a background of mental health issues, it is important to tell your psychiatrist about these issues.

The time needed to complete an ADHD evaluation can vary depending on the severity of your symptoms. A comprehensive ADHD assessment can last up to three hours. The psychiatrist will review your symptoms and speak with your family and friends. They will then write a report and send it to you for your review.

Experience

A private ADHD diagnosis is a great method of getting a thorough assessment of your disorder. This will also help you comprehend how your condition affects the people around you as well as you. However, it is important to remember that the diagnosis is only the first step, and there is a lot more work to be done before you can receive treatment. A psychiatrist will employ a variety of tests to determine whether you suffer from ADHD. You can also expect a complete psychological examination which will include a history of your family and other factors that may influence your condition.

When choosing a psychiatrist to conduct your personal ADHD assessment, consider their expertise. They must have extensive experience treating dealing with adult adhd private assessment ireland and other mental conditions. They should be knowledgeable about co-occurring disorders, like anxiety and depression. In addition, they should be able to tell when ADHD isn't the sole cause and recommend treatment for any other issues.

In an ADHD assessment, the clinician will require you to complete questionnaires and evaluate your behavior in various situations. They may also observe you in a real-life situation and inquire about your family history. The test takes about an hour. It is recommended to have someone who you trust by your side for help.

The cost of an ADHD assessment is contingent upon where you live and which doctor you select. Certain insurance companies will cover the cost for an assessment, while others might require a copayment. It is essential to know the fees prior to making an appointment, regardless of your insurance.

Psychiatry UK provides gold-standard ADHD assessments at affordable costs. These tests are performed by a multidisciplinary group that includes psychiatrists and psychologists. The assessments are based on NICE guidelines and are recognized by the NHS. The assessments are also available for people who aren't connected to a NHS GP, or are waiting on a Maudsley referral list. They are accessible at less than the cost that you might pay for an NHS assessment and medication.
